[QUOTE="Systemlord, post: 122086, member: 15832"] You keep circling right back around the advice you have been given, doing what you want to do instead of what you should do is going to greatly affect any outcome. Your testosterone levels will drop dramatically days after your injection, over time you will feel no relief from each injection. Your ability to hold onto your testosterone is greatly diminished by your very low SHBG. Large injections will lower your already low SHBG even lower, smaller injections will minimize the impact to SHBG levels. Once you start using these insulin syringes you're going to laugh at how painless and easy it is, I never feel the needle going in. Everyday injections or BUST. [/QUOTE]
